Unfortunately some pharmaceutical manufacturers restrict the production of medications in order to push the price up. The pharmacist has to hunt down these medicines from the suppliers.  This can mean a wait and all sorts of problems.  I have a been taking a combination of medicines over the last 10 years and this problem has always occurred and recurs fairly frequently.  Therefore nothing to do with Brexit.
